What is SideQuest - Just Because?

SideQuest is a lifestyle app for iOS that delivers deterministic daily and weekly tasks to a local-only, privacy-focused device environment.

Users hire SideQuest for low-friction, spontaneous mindfulness that avoids the social and data-privacy costs of traditional habit-tracking apps.

What Are The Key Features?

Deterministic Daily QuestsDifferentiator

Delivers one non-rerollable task per day to the local device, reducing decision fatigue.

Local-Only StorageDifferentiator

Stores all user data on-device with no server transmission, acting as a privacy-first barrier.

How's The Lifestyle Market?

SideQuest occupies a niche as an "anti-habit" utility. By eschewing accounts, server-side storage, and subscription gates, it appeals to privacy-conscious users who reject the data-harvesting models of mainstream lifestyle apps. Its lack of monetization creates a clear value gap against rivals that gate features behind recurring payments.
